词汇 irate
释义 irate
adjective
uk /aɪˈreɪt/ us /aɪˈreɪt/
very angry: 极其愤怒的,大怒的
We have received some irate phone calls from customers.我们接到了不少顾客打来怒气冲冲的电话。
